On Sun, 18 Dec 2016 09:41:29, Corinna Vinschen wrote:
> - Fix regression in console charset handling
> Addresses: https://cygwin.com/ml/cygwin/2016-10/msg00000.html
It looks like fixing this may have caused another issue. Example test:
With cmd.exe, you can type Alt 234 and it produces
GREEK CAPITAL LETTER OMEGA U+03A9. However with Cygwin via Cygwin.bat it yields
nothing. Non ASCII characters can be read from scripts, but they cannot be
entered interactively.
They cannot be pasted either; pasting some words will remove all non ASCII
characters.
I believe this to be a recent issue, if memory serves this did work before, and
should given that cmd.exe handles it fine.
